Re: 72 Cheyenne Super Plain Jane

Been a while since I've updated this thing. My front wheels showed up yesterday but I'm not home so I don't have any pictures. They are 20x8.5 with 5" of bs. I have been tinkering with all of the wiring and a bunch of little stupid things and everything is basically complete. My to-do list is exhaust, shocks, center link, rearend, driveshaft, finish paint, and glass. The rearend should be done by the weekend. Its a custom nickel plated 9" floater 59" face to face. Once the rear is here it'll be a roller and off to paint it goes. I have been stupid busy up at school with the semester nearing completion so I'll have some pictures for you guys by the end of next week.

Re: 72 Cheyenne Super Plain Jane

Some minor updates. I got the radiator overflow line ran and polished and finished the brake lines running from the master to the proportioning valve. The spindles are having new brake brackets put on right now and should be done early next week. Once those are done they will go to powder and then final installation. I will be picking up the rear end housing tomorrow and then it's going straight to paint. Impatiently waiting, let me know what you guys think

Re: 72 Cheyenne Super Plain Jane

Little update, finally after four months of waiting I have my own rear end housing. Nickel plated nine inch built to width with the right brake brackets. Let me know what you guys think. Spindles are at powdercoat and I will be picking them up Tuesday or Wednesday and then it'll be a roller. If I don't have any more hiccups I should be able to get it to paint on Friday
